Description
Elbows provide an excellent method of diverting a plumbing line without the risk of causing kinks in the tubing. Compression fittings are constructed of lead-free brass and are ideal for multiple potable water and other liquid plumbing systems. Each compression connection for each fitting comes with a ferrule and insert for a secure project installation. This type of fitting is ideal for connecting to aluminum tubing, brass pipe, copper tubing and polyethylene tubing.
